PRE-AUTHORIZATION AT CHECK-IN:
We may pre-authorize your card at check-in.  A pre-authorization is a temporary hold of a specific amount of your available credit limit balance placed on your credit/debit card for the full amount of your intended stay, plus tax.  All credit/debit cards are pre-authorized at check-in.  Pre-authorization is not a charge to your account, it is a hold on those funds.  Once your actual charge is posted at check-out it can take anywhere from 24 hours to 30 days for the original pre-authorization to be removed by your bank.  Generally, most banks release the hold within 3-5 days.  It is your responsibility to be aware of how your bank handles all of your transactions, including pre-authorizations.  We are unable to remove pre-authorizations directly through our resort.
